基于混合蚁群算法的物流配送路径问题  被引量:10

Research on the routing problem in logistics distribution based on mixed ant colony algorithm

摘  要:蚁群算法在解决旅行商等著名问题时得到了卓有成效的应用,但解决大规模问题时,其收敛速度较慢且耗时较长;同样,郭涛算法在解决复杂优化问题时取得了良好效果,但会产生大量无为的冗余迭代,求解效率低;文章汲取蚁群算法和郭涛算法的优点,提出混合蚁群算法,建立混合蚁群算法数学模型,得到时间效率和求解效率都比较好的一种新的启发式算法。The ant colony arithmetic has been successfully applied to solving the famous traveling salesman problem, but when it confronts large-scale problems, its convergence velocity becomes relatively slow and its computation is time-consuming. Similarly, Guo's algorithm has produced good results when the complex optimization problems are solved, but a great number of useless redundancy iterations come out and the solution efficiency is low. This paper makes use of merits of both the ant colony arithmetic and Guo's algorithm to propose a mixed ant colony arithmetic, and a mixed ant colony arithmetic mathematical model is established. The algorithm is a new enlightening method, and its time efficiency and solution efficiency are much better.
